Using the Base Answering Machine When the answering machine is off, the LED display at the base will be blank. The LED display is a message counter when the answering machine is on. When there are new messages, the number of new messages will be displayed and will be blinking. You may review messages from the base using the following keys. (Play/Stop) - Press to play messages/stop messages. If there are new messages the answering machine will play new messages. If there are no new messages, the answering machine will play back old messages. (Repeat/back) - Repeat the playing message/back to the previous message. (Skip) - Skip to the next message. (Answering Machine On/Off) - Press to switch answer setting On or Off. (Delete) - Press during message playback to delete current message. In standby, a short press prompts a confirmation tone and another press will delete all old messages. [41]
